Summary
OpenAI has announced a price reduction for ChatGPT Business, its enterprise-tier offering designed for organizations. The move aims to make advanced AI capabilities more accessible to mid-market and larger enterprises that rely on ChatGPT for business operations. This pricing adjustment reflects OpenAI's strategy to expand its commercial customer base while maintaining profitability through scale. The company continues to refine its pricing structure across its consumer and enterprise product lines to balance accessibility with business sustainability.
